CircLigase- ssDNA Ligase
- Production of ssDNA templates for rolling-circle replication or rolling-circle transcription experiments.
- Production of ssDNA templates for RNA polymerase and RNA polymerase inhibitor assays.
CircLigase™ ssDNA Ligase* is a thermostable ATP-dependent ligase that
catalyzes intramolecular ligation (i.e. circularization) of ssDNA templates
having a 5´-phosphate and a 3´-hydroxyl group. In contrast to T4
DNA Ligase and Ampligase®DNA Ligase, which ligate DNA ends
that are annealed adjacent to each other on a complementary DNA sequence, CircLigase
ssDNA Ligase ligates ends of ssDNA in the absence of a complementary sequence.
The enzyme is therefore useful for making circular ssDNA molecules from linear
ssDNA. Circular ssDNA molecules can be used as substrates for rolling-circle
replication or rolling-circle transcription.
Linear ssDNA of >30 bases is circularized by CircLigase enzyme. Under standard
reaction conditions, virtually no linear concatamers or circular concatamers
are produced. In addition to its activity on ssDNA, CircLigase enzyme also
has activity in ligating a single-stranded nucleic acid having a 3´-hydroxyl
ribonucleotide and a 5´-phosphorylated ribonucleotide or deoxyribonucleotide.
Unit Definition:One unit of CircLigase enzyme converts 1 pmol of a linear 5´-phosphorylated CircLigase Standard 55-mer Oligo into an exonuclease I-resistant circular form in 1 hour at 60°C under standard assay conditions.
Storage Buffer:50% glycerol containing 50 mM Tris-HCl (pH 7.5), 100 mM NaCl, 0.1 mM EDTA, 1 mM DTT, and 0.1% Triton®X-100. 10X Reaction Buffer:0.5 M MOPS (pH 7.5), 0.1 M KCl, 50 mM MgCl2, and 10 mM DTT. The Reaction Buffer does not containATP or MnCl2which must be added to the reaction at final concentrations of 0.05 mM ATP and 2.5 mM MnCl2. A 2.5-mM solution of ATP and a 50-mM solution of MnCl2are included. Quality Control:CircLigase ssDNA Ligase is free of detectable phosphatase, DNA exo- and endonuclease, and RNase activities. Figure 1. CircLigase™ ssDNA Ligase converts linear ssDNA to circular ssDNA. A 71-base ssDNA oligo was converted to a circular DNA form in a reaction containing CircLigase™ ssDNA Ligase and ATP. Lane 1, DNA markers. Lane 2, 71-base ssDNA. Lane 3, circularization proceeds through an adenylated intermediate. Lane 4, the closed circular nature of the reaction product was confirmed by treating the reaction with exonuclease I, which specifically digests linear DNA.
